Thought suppression
Thought suppression is a psychoanalytical defense mechanism. It is a type of motivated forgetting in which an individual consciously attempts to stop thinking about a particular thought. It is often associated with obsessive–compulsive disorder (OCD). OCD is when a person will repeatedly (usually unsuccessfully) attempt to prevent or "neutralize" intrusive distressing thoughts centered on one or more obsessions. It is also thought to be a cause of memory inhibition, as shown by research using the think/no think paradigm. Thought suppression is relevant to both mental and behavioral levels, possibly leading to effects which intensify the intrusive thought, which is contrary to the intention. Ironic process theory is one cognitive model that can explain the paradoxical effect.
When an individual tries to suppress thoughts under a high cognitive load, the frequency of those thoughts increases and becomes more accessible than before. Evidence shows that people can prevent their thoughts from being translated into behavior when self-monitoring is high; this does not apply to automatic behaviors though, and may result in latent, unconscious actions. This phenomenon is made paradoxically worse by increasing the amount of distractions a person has, although the experiments in this area can be criticized for using impersonal concurrent tasks, which may or may not properly reflect natural processes or individual differences.
In order for thought suppression and its effectiveness to be studied, researchers have had to find methods of recording the processes going on in the mind. One experiment designed with this purpose was performed by Wegner, Schneider, Carter & White. They asked participants to avoid thinking of a specific target (e.g. a white bear) for five minutes, but if they did, they were told then to ring a bell. After this, participants were told that for the next five minutes they were to think about the target. There was evidence that unwanted thoughts occurred more frequently in those who used thought suppression compared to those who were not. Furthermore, there was also evidence that during the second stage, those who had used thought suppression had a higher frequency of target thoughts than did those who hadn't used thought suppression; later coined the rebound effect. This effect has been replicated and can even be done with implausible targets, such as the thought of a "green rabbit". From these implications, Wegner eventually developed the "ironic process theory".
To better elucidate the findings of thought suppression, several studies have changed the target thought. Roemer and Borkovec found that participants who suppressed anxious or depressing thoughts showed a significant rebound effect. Furthermore, Wenzlaff, Wegner, & Roper demonstrated that anxious or depressed subjects were less likely to suppress negative, unwanted thoughts. Despite Rassin, Merkelbach and Muris reporting that this finding is moderately robust in the literature, some studies were unable to replicate results. However, this may be explained by a consideration of individual differences.
Recent research found that for individuals with low anxiety and high desirability traits (repressors), suppressed anxious autobiographical events initially intruded fewer times than in other groups (low, high, and high defensive anxious groups). However, after seven days it was found that repressors experienced more intrusive thoughts regarding those anxious autobiographical events than the other groups, thus demonstrating that repression works for the short run, but is not sustainable. This difference in coping style may account for the disparities within the literature. That said, the problem remains that the cause of the paradoxical effect may be in the thought tapping measures used (e.g. bell ringing). Evidence from Brown (1990) that showed participants were very sensitive to frequency information prompted Clarke, Ball and Pape to obtain participants' aposterio estimates of the number of intrusive target thoughts and found the same pattern of paradoxical results. However, even though such a method appears to overcome the problem, it and all the other methodologies use self-report as the primary form of data-collection. This may be problematic because of response distortion or inaccuracy in self-reporting.
Thought suppression also has the capability to change human behavior. Macrae, Bodenhausen, Milne, and Jetten found that when people were asked not to think about the stereotypes of a certain group (e.g. a "skinhead"), their written descriptions about a group member's typical day contained less stereotypical thoughts. However, when they were told they were going to meet an individual they had just written about, those in the suppression group sat significantly farther away from the "skinhead" (just by virtue of his clothes being present). These results show that even though there may have been an initial enhancement of the stereotype, participants were able to prevent this from being communicated in their writing; this was not true for their behavior though.
Further experiments have documented similar findings. In one study from 1993, when participants were given cognitively demanding concurrent tasks, the results showed a paradoxical higher frequency of target thoughts than controls. However other controlled studies have not shown such effects. For example, Wenzlaff and Bates found that subjects concentrating on a positive task experienced neither paradoxical effects nor rebound effects—even when challenged with cognitive load. Wenzlaff and Bates also note that the beneficiality of concentration in their study participants was optimized when the subjects employed positive thoughts.
Some studies have shown that when test subjects are under what Wegner refers to as a "cognitive load" (for instance, using multiple external distractions to try to suppress a target thought), the effectiveness of thought suppression appears to be reduced. However, in other studies in which focused distraction is used, long term effectiveness may improve. That is, successful suppression may involve less distractors. For example, in 1987 Wegner, Schneider, Carter & White found that a single, pre-determined distracter (e.g., a red Volkswagen) was sufficient to eliminate the paradoxical effect post-testing. Evidence from Bowers and Woody in 1996 is supportive of the finding that hypnotized individuals produce no paradoxical effects. This rests on the assumption that deliberate "distracter activity" is bypassed in such an activity.
